Graphical-Photo-Organizer
A C# WPF utility for organizing folders of photos and videos based on when they were taken. (by ellman12)
TagLib#
Library for reading and writing metadata in media files (by mono)

Where does photo metadata come from?
When a photo is imported into a library, Jellyfin reads the EXIF/XMP properties from the file and populates the corresponding Jellyfin properties (a.k.a. metadata). (Actually it uses a package named taglib-sharp to read the properties from the file.)
